DevGraham:
The CSS style for paragraphs is the P tag (Normal in the
style pull-down); if done correctly, all new paragraphs will use
the assigned style.
Headings, of course, are the H1, H2, etc.
Tables themselves are not controlled by styles, except for
the text within them (we use TableHead and TableRow styles for
this). For pre-formatted tables, check out Peter's
excellent
tutorial on that subject.
Stay away from styles for lists, especially if you'll also be
generating Printed Doc output. Just use the Normal style, then
select the list items and click the Bullet or Number icon in the RH
toolbar; for nested lists, see
Snippet
#50, also on Peter's site.
